Yes, under copyright law in many jurisdictions (like the US), a transfer of exclusive copyright ownership must be in writing and signed by the owner.
This template includes a waiver of moral rights where permitted by law. Moral rights (like the right to be credited) are separate from economic rights and can sometimes be retained even after transfer.
No, copyright exists from the moment of creation. However, registration provides additional legal benefits, such as the ability to sue for statutory damages.
Generally, you can agree to transfer future works (e.g., in an employment context), but this specific agreement is best used for existing works identified in the document.
